Read allPoor Spookley is a pumpkin who's shape is square rather then round. He's teased and taunted by other mean round pumpkins. But he receives help from a Scarecrow and his 2 bat side-kicks and 3 very funny spiders.Poor Spookley is a pumpkin who's shape is square rather then round. He's teased and taunted by other mean round pumpkins. But he receives help from a Scarecrow and his 2 bat side-kicks and 3 very funny spiders.

    5bobbyd61074

    REALLY REALLY MEDIOCRE BUT THAT'S OK

    Short and sweet review just like the movie. Misfit pumpkin whose not accepted by other more traditionally shaped pumpkins in the patch has to overcome bla bla bla. It's a poor man's Rudolph the Red-Nose Reindeer. But it's message of acceptance is one that you'd appreciate your child hearing. Definitely a tad juvenile....I'd say 2-7 years old would be the best audience. Animation had a cheap feel to it but my son watched this multiple times over the years and tonight I'm watching it in its entirety with him. Yet he still seems entertained at age 9, so how bad could it be? Sometimes OK....is OK I guess.
    1jcass-78940

    A poorly made Roudolf rip-off...but for Halloween

    This movie is supposed to be all about not judging someone based on their appearance but is nothing but rip-offs and lazy "humor" even by toddler standards. They have TWO "slow" or intellectually challenged characters that are played for laughs which again is lazy and runs against the "don't judge" message. They have TWO Joe Pesci from Goodfellas rip-off characters. They also rip-off the Olympic games for some reason. Terrible songs, terrible animation, terrible voice acting. My young child thought it was "okay" and I thought it was a very long 45 minutes.
